SEC XBRL Company Facts Scraper API

Turn SEC Company Facts into source-linked public-company financial metric evidence. Resolve ticker/company/CIK and filter exact taxonomy concepts, units, forms, fiscal periods, filed/end dates, and amendments.

Default input

{
"ticker": "AAPL",
"taxonomies": ["us-gaap"],
"concepts": ["RevenueFromContractWithCustomerExcludingAssessedTax", "NetIncomeLoss", "Assets", "Liabilities"],
"forms": ["10-K"],
"units": ["USD"],
"maxResults": 4
}

This returns up to four recent Apple facts for at most $0.0081 ($0.0001 start + $0.002/item).

Output and controls

Every found item includes CIK, resolved ticker, entity name, taxonomy, concept/label, unit/value, period, fiscal year/period, form, amendment flag, accession, official filing link, Company Facts URL, retrieval time, and disclosed query bounds. Duplicate SEC contexts are preserved rather than silently collapsed.

Use independent maxConcepts, maxContextsPerConcept, maxCandidates, and maxResults controls for predictable runtime and cost. Temporary official-source failures and no matches produce explicit evidence outcomes.

Important limits

Company Facts is issuer-filed XBRL evidence. Values may be amended, restated, duplicated, issuer-specific, or context-dependent. The actor does not provide SEC verification, audited normalization, complete statements, valuation, or investment advice. Review the linked filing, footnotes, context, and later amendments before material decisions.
